Atrooz OM, Hiresh MN, Dlewan AR, Atrooz MO, Hiresh GN, Alasoufi AM, Atrooz IO. Prevalence of dyslipidemia and the association with levels of TSH and T4 hormones among patients in south region of Jordan. J Med Biochem 2023; 42:706-713. Abstract
BACKGROUND Glycolipid metabolism disorders (dysglycolipidemia) are characterized by elevated levels of glycolipid profile components and fasting blood glucose. Dysglycolipidemia are major threats to human health and life. Therefore, the aim of this cross-sectional study is to estimate the prevalence of dysglycolipidemia and the existence of association of TSH and T4 and glycolipid profiles. METHODS Cross-sectional data were obtained from the medical laboratory of Ma'an Governmental Hospital. A total of 141 patients' results were collected (18-60 years). Differences in the glycolipidemic profiles according to age and sex and TSH and T4 were compared. Different statistical analyses were used to analyze the prevalence of dysglycolipidemia and the correlation with the levels of TSH and T4. RESULTS The study involved results of 141 patients (54.7% males and 45.3% females) in Ma'an Province (Jordan), who visited the internal medicine clinic at Ma'an Governmental Hospital. Patients have overweight and BMI of more than 25 kg/m2. The overall results of the prevalence of dyslipidemia indicated that patients have 42.5% of hypercholesterolemia, 48.2% of high LDL-C, 34.1% of hypertriglyceridemia, and 41.8% of low HDL-C. The prevalence of isolated lipid profiles showed that 10 patients have mixed dyslipidemia. The association of dyslipidemia with age indicated a positive significance between triglyceride and older people (≥40 years), while HDL levels have a significance with gender (p=0.025). The overall ANOVA model yielded non-statistical significant results between levels of any components of lipid profile and levels of TSH and T4 hormones. Welch test (p=0.036) showed positive significance between levels of fasting blood glucose and triglyceride levels. CONCLUSIONS Our results showed and confirmed the presence of a high percentage of hyperlipidemia in Ma'an province and there was no relationship with levels of TSH and T4. A relationship exists between levels of triglycerides and blood glucose concentrations.

Ali N, Kathak RR, Fariha KA, Taher A, Islam F. Prevalence of dyslipidemia and its associated factors among university academic staff and students in Bangladesh. BMC Cardiovasc Disord 2023; 23:366. Abstract
BACKGROUND Dyslipidemia is one of the important contributors to cardiovascular disease and type 2 diabetes. There is little or no information on dyslipidemia among academic staff and students in Bangladesh. Therefore, this study aimed to investigate the prevalence and factors related to dyslipidemia among university academic staff and students in Bangladesh. METHODS A total of 533 participants (302 academic staff and 231 students) were enrolled in this cross-sectional study. A simple random sampling technique was used to enrol the participants. Fasting blood samples were obtained from the participants, and serum levels of triglycerides (TG), total cholesterol (TC), high-density lipoprotein cholesterol (HDL-C) and low-density lipoprotein cholesterol (LDL-C) were measured using the standard methods. Dyslipidemia was defined according to the National Cholesterol Education Program Adult Treatment Panel III (NCEP-ATP-III) model guideline. Multivariable logistic regression was conducted to identify the factors related to lipid marker abnormalities. RESULTS Overall, the prevalence of dyslipidemia was 81.5%, of which 85% was in staff and 76.5% in students. A significant difference was found in the prevalence of dyslipidemia between males and females only in the student group (p < 0.01). Among staff, hypertriglyceridemia prevalence was 49.7%, hypercholesterolemia 23%, high LDL-C 24.7% and low HDL-C 77.3%. On the other hand, hypertriglyceridemia prevalence was 39%, hypercholesterolemia 25.6%, high LDL-C 26.5% and low HDL-C 69.3% among students. The most common lipid abnormality was low HDL-C in both groups. The prevalence of mixed dyslipidemia was 14.2% and 14.1% in staff and students, respectively. According to the regression analysis, increased age, obesity, diabetes, and inadequate physical activity were significantly associated with dyslipidemia. CONCLUSIONS Dyslipidemia was prevalent among the majority of the study participants. Increased age, obesity, diabetes, and inadequate physical activity were significantly associated with dyslipidemia. The study's results highlight the importance of implementing interventions to address the associated risk factors of dyslipidemia among academic staff and students in Bangladesh.

Ali N, Samadder M, Kathak RR, Islam F. Prevalence and factors associated with dyslipidemia in Bangladeshi adults. PLoS One 2023; 18:e0280672. Abstract
BACKGROUND Dyslipidemia is one of the modifiable risk factors for cardiovascular disease and a leading cause of morbidity and mortality worldwide. This study was designed to estimate the prevalence and factors associated with dyslipidemia in Bangladeshi adults. METHODS A total of 603 participants aged ≥ 18 years were recruited in the study. Serum levels of total cholesterol (TC), triglycerides (TG), low-density lipoprotein (LDL) and high-density lipoprotein (HDL) were analyzed using enzymatic colorimetric methods. Dyslipidemia was defined based on serum lipids levels following the standard guidelines by National Cholesterol Education Program Adult Treatment Panel III. Multivariate logistic regression analysis was applied to evaluate risk factors associated with dyslipidemia. RESULTS The overall prevalence of dyslipidemia was 89% with no significant difference between male (90.1%) and female (85.7) subjects. The prevalence of hypertriglyceridemia was 51.7%, hypercholesterolemia 41.6%, high LDL 43.9% and low HDL 78.8%. When participants were classified into healthy control, hypertensive and diabetic groups, the lipid levels and prevalence of lipid abnormalities were higher in hypertensive and diabetic groups compared to the control group. Low HDL level was the main prevalent dyslipidemia among study subjects. The prevalence of isolated hypertriglyceridemia, isolated hypercholesterolemia, and isolated low HDL-C was 24.7%, 14.7%, and 25.5%, respectively. Mixed hyperlipidemia was prevalent in 26.9% of the participants. According to the logistic regression analysis, significant associated factors of dyslipidemia were increased age, overweight, general and abdominal obesity, hypertension, diabetes and inadequate physical activity. CONCLUSIONS This study shows a high prevalence of dyslipidemia in Bangladeshi adults. Important risk factors of dyslipidemia are increased age, overweight, general and abdominal obesity, diabetes, hypertension and low physical activity. Our results suggest that awareness-raising programs are required to prevent and control dyslipidemia among Bangladeshi adults.

Kumar H, Bhardwaj K, Cruz-Martins N, Sharma R, Siddiqui SA, Dhanjal DS, Singh R, Chopra C, Dantas A, Verma R, Dosoky NS, Kumar D. Phyto-Enrichment of Yogurt to Control Hypercholesterolemia: A Functional Approach. Molecules 2022; 27:molecules27113479. Abstract
Cholesterol is essential for normal human health, but elevations in its serum levels have led to the development of various complications, including hypercholesterolemia (HC). Cholesterol accumulation in blood circulation formsplaques on artery walls and worsens the individuals’ health. To overcome this complication, different pharmacological and non-pharmacological approaches are employed to reduce elevated blood cholesterol levels. Atorvastatin and rosuvastatin are the most commonly used drugs, but their prolonged use leads to several acute side effects. In recent decades, the potential benefit of ingesting yogurt on lipid profile has attracted the interest of researchers and medical professionals worldwide. This review aims to give an overview of the current knowledge about HC and the different therapeutic approaches. It also discusses the health benefits of yogurt consumption and highlights the overlooked phyto-enrichment option to enhance the yogurt’s quality. Finally, clinical studies using different phyto-enriched yogurts for HC management are also reviewed. Yogurt has a rich nutritional value, but its processing degrades the content of minerals, vitamins, and other vital constituents with beneficial health effects. The option of enriching yogurt with phytoconstituents has drawn a lot of attention. Different pre-clinical and clinical studies have provided new insights on their benefits on gut microbiota and human health. Thus, the yogurtphyto-enrichment with stanol and β-glucan have opened new paths in functional food industries and found healthy andeffective alternatives for HC all along with conventional treatment approaches.

Campos MLD, Castro MBD, Campos AD, Fernandes MF, Conegundes JLM, Rodrigues MN, Mügge FLB, Silva AMD, Sabarense CM, Castañon MCMN, Andreazzi AE, Scio E. Antiobesity, hepatoprotective and anti-hyperglycemic effects of a pharmaceutical formulation containing Cecropia pachystachya Trécul in mice fed with a hypercaloric diet. JOURNAL OF ETHNOPHARMACOLOGY 2021; 280:114418. Abstract
ETHNOPHARMACOLOGICAL RELEVANCE The leaves of Cecropia pachystachya Trécul (Urticaceae), known as embaúba, are used as hypoglycemic and for weight reduction in Brazilian traditional medicine. AIM OF THE STUDY This study investigated the effects of a pharmaceutical formulation (ECP20) containing C. pachystachya extract on some metabolic alterations caused by a hypercaloric diet in mice. MATERIAL AND METHODS Mice were randomly fed with a standard or hypercaloric diet and orally treated with ECP20 or vehicle for 13 weeks. Subsequently, adiposity, glucose intolerance, and the presence of nonalcoholic fatty liver disease were assessed. Adipose tissue and liver were collected after euthanasia and frozen at -80 °C for histological and antioxidant analyzes. The effect of ECP20 on the differentiation of 3T3-L1 pre-adipocytes was also investigated. RESULTS Animals treated with ECP20 showed less weight gain, reduced glycemia, glucose tolerance restored, and hepatoprotective effect. Also, ECP20 presented significant in vivo antioxidant activity. Treatment of 3T3-L1 preadipocytes with ECP20 did not inhibit cellular differencing. CONCLUSIONS Therefore, ECP20 presented promising effects in the control of obesity and related disorders. Considering that glucose intolerance and hyperglycemia are strong evidence for the development of type 2 diabetes, the findings corroborated the traditional use of C. pachystachya to treat this disease. The chlorogenic acid and the flavonoids orientin and iso-orientin, present in the extract, might be involved in the activities found.

Association between qat chewing and dyslipidaemia among young males. J Taibah Univ Med Sci 2019; 14:538-546. Abstract
Objectives This study investigated the association between qat chewing and prevalence and patterns of dyslipidaemia among young Yemeni males. Methods In this cross-sectional study, we used a multistage random cluster sampling method. Data were obtained using a questionnaire. Additionally, anthropometric measurements and fasting blood samples were collected. We used Program-Adult Treatment Panel III. The blood samples were analysed for lipid profile measurements including levels of total cholesterol, triglycerides, low-density lipoprotein cholesterol (LDL-C), and high-density lipoprotein cholesterol (HDL-C). Results A total of 440 Yemeni male with mean age of 21.4 ± 3.6 years were enrolled. The students were divided into the following two groups—qat chewers (n = 283) and non-qat chewers (n = 77). The overall occurrence of dyslipidaemia was significantly higher in qat chewers than that in non-qat chewers (89.8% versus 80.5%) (P < 0.05). Hypercholesterolaemia, hypertriglyceridaemia, high LDL-C level, and mixed hyperlipidaemia were lower in qat chewers than in non-qat chewers (16.6%, 58.3%, 16.3%, and 10.6%, respectively, versus 20.8%, 64.9%, 18.2%, and 20.8%, respectively). Isolated hypertriglyceridaemia was slightly higher in qat chewers than in non-qat chewers (47.7% versus 44.2%). However, the incidence of low HDL-C level, isolated low HDL-C level, and isolated hypercholesterolaemia were generally higher in qat chewers than in non-qat chewers (83%, 25.1%, and 6%, respectively, versus 75.3%, 15.6%, and 0%, respectively). Conclusion This study showed high prevalence of dyslipidaemia among Yemeni male qat chewers. Low HDL-C level was the main lipid variable, followed by hypertriglyceridaemia. Genetic factors, war conditions, physical inactivity, and low-fat traditional Yemeni diet were considered the determinants of the study findings.

Al-Duais MA, Al-Awthan YS. Prevalence of dyslipidemia among students of a Yemeni University. J Taibah Univ Med Sci 2019; 14:163-171. Abstract
Objectives To estimate the prevalence of dyslipidemia and patterns of lipid profile and associated factors among Yemeni university students. Methods This cross-sectional study included 240 Yemeni students (116 males and 124 females) at Ibb University. The students were randomly selected from various faculties of the university. Demographic and clinical data were obtained from all participants. Fasting blood specimens were collected from all students for measurement of serum levels of total cholesterol (TC), triglycerides (TG), low-density lipoprotein cholesterol (LDL-C), and high-density lipoprotein cholesterol (HDL-C). The criteria of the National Cholesterol Education Program-Adult Treatment Panel III (NCEP-ATP III) were used. Results The mean age of the studied cohort was 19.8 ± 1.8 years; 48.3% were men and 51.7% were women. About 56.7% of the participants were from rural areas. Qat chewers and cigarette smokers comprised 63.3% and 6.7% of the cohort, respectively. No obese students were found in this study; however, 11.7% were overweight. The overall prevalence of dyslipidemia, hypercholesterolemia, hypertriglyceridemia, high LDL-C, and low HDL-C among the participating students were 86.7%, 21.7%, 23.8%, 31.7%, and 81.7%, respectively. Mixed hyperlipidemia was present in 8.8% of the students. The prevalence of isolated hypercholesterolemia, hypertriglyceridemia, and low HDL-C was 12.9%, 15%, and 70%, respectively. Dyslipidemia was significantly associated with male sex, increasing age, urban residence, and medical and natural science faculties. In contrast, smoking, qat chewing, physical activity, and the consumption of fast food, fruits and vegetables, and fish were not significantly associated with dyslipidemia. Conclusion To our knowledge, this is the first human study conducted at Ibb University during wartime in Yemen. Dyslipidemia was highly prevalent among healthy Yemeni university students in Ibb city. Low HDL-C was the most prevalent type of dyslipidemia, followed by increased levels of LDL-C. Gender, age, residence, and type of faculty were also closely related to dyslipidemia. These results indicate the need for specialized programs to determine blood lipid levels and initiate intervention programs to reduce the prevalence and prevent the complications of dyslipidemia among Yemeni university students.

Zarrazquin Arizaga I, Atucha AF, Kortajarena M, Torres-Unda J, Irazusta A, Ruiz-Litago F, Irazusta J, Casis L, Fraile-Bermúdez AB. Associations of Anthropometric Characteristics, Dietary Habits, and Aerobic Capacity With Cardiovascular Risk Factors of Health-Science Students. Biol Res Nurs 2018; 20:549-557. Abstract
The aim of this cross-sectional study was to study the relative importance of dietary habits and aerobic capacity in parameters related to cardiovascular risk in 271 female and 95 male health-science students (mean age = 19.1 ± 1.4 years). In females, fatty-meat consumption predicted triglycerides (β = .649, p < .001) and high-density lipoprotein (HDL; β = -.242, p = .001) and low-density lipoprotein (LDL; β = .373, p < .001) cholesterol levels. Consumption of nuts, legumes, and complex carbohydrates predicted triglyceride (β = -.099, p = .074), HDL (β = .231, p = .001), and LDL (β = -.155, p = .025) levels, respectively. Aerobic capacity (β = -.245, p < .001) and fatty-meat intake (β = .230, p < .001) predicted diastolic blood pressure (BP); body mass index (BMI) predicted systolic BP (β = .340, p < .001). In males, body fat percentage was the strongest predictor of triglycerides (β = .348, p = .004), cholesterol (β = .366, p = .006), HDL (β = -.378, p = .004), and LDL (β = .271, p = .043) levels. Aerobic capacity (β = -.263, p = .013) and fatty-meat consumption (β = .334, p = .005) independently predicted triglyceride levels. Nut (β = -.286, p = .013) and fatty-meat intake (β = .361, p = .002) predicted systolic BP, while BMI predicted diastolic BP (β = .209, p = .045). As health sciences students, these participants are future health professionals; targeting such populations is important for chronic disease prevention.

Baynouna LM, Nagelkerke NJ, Al Ameri TA, Al Deen SMZ, Ali HI. Determinants of diabetes and hypertension control in ambulatory healthcare in Al ain, United arab emirates. Oman Med J 2014; 29:234-8. Abstract
OBJECTIVES This study aims to study determinants for the control of diabetes and hypertension in Al Ain Ambulatory Healthcare patients. METHOD This is a cross sectional observational study of patients attending ambulatory healthcare centers in Al Ain, United Arab Emirates in 2009. From a yearly audit evaluating the care of patients with diabetes and hypertension, the determinants for improved diabetes and hypertension outcomes were identified from a total of 512 patients and its association with glycemic and blood pressure control were studied. RESULTS From all variables studied, only the clinic where the patient was treated helped predict both improved blood sugar and blood pressure control. For patients with diabetes, poor control the year before (p<0.001), the number of chronic disease clinic visits (p=0.042) and triglyceride levels (p=0.007) predicted worse control of diabetes. A predictor of poor control of blood pressure (p<0.001) for patients with hypertension was poor control of blood pressure in the year before. CONCLUSION In this population, the healthcare system and the team played major roles as determinants in the control of patient's diabetes and blood pressure more than any of the other factors examined.
